Australia's AICIS Updates Inventory, Adds One New Chemical

On December 2, 2025, under Section 82 of the Industrial Chemicals Act 2019, Australia added one industrial chemical to the Australian Inventory of Industrial Chemicals (AIIC). This addition follows the completion of a five-year period since the issuance of its industrial chemical assessment certificate.

Newly Added Chemical:

Chemical Name

1,3-Cyclohexanedimethanamine, N1,N3-bis(2-methylpropylidene)-

CAS Number

173904-11-5

Specific information requirements

Obligations to provide information apply. You must tell us within 28 days if the circumstances of your importation or manufacture (introduction) are different to those in our assessment.

Listing Date

28 November 2025

Manufacturers and importers of chemicals must strictly adhere to relevant legal requirements to ensure all operations comply with national safety standards. Through these regulations, AICIS aims to enhance the management efficiency of industrial chemicals while ensuring their use does not pose a threat to the environment or public health.
